An 8-week ACT prep class typically covers all four sections of the test: English, Math, Reading, and Science, plus the optional Writing section. The curriculum focuses on test-specific strategies, question formats, timing techniques, and practice with real ACT problems. By condensing prep into 8 weeks, the class maintains momentum and keeps students focused on high-impact study habits rather than spreading preparation too thin over several months.
Score improvement depends on your starting point and study effort, but students typically see 2-5 point increases with focused, structured prep—and some see even more. The key is identifying your specific weak areas early and targeting those sections intensively. An 8-week timeline is ideal for this because it's long enough to build real skills but short enough to maintain consistent momentum and see meaningful results before test day.
Pacing is one of the biggest challenges students face, especially on the Reading and Science sections where time pressure is intense. Expert tutors teach strategic approaches like knowing when to skip difficult questions, using process-of-elimination efficiently, and practicing timed drills to build speed without sacrificing accuracy. The 8-week format allows enough time to practice these strategies repeatedly until they become automatic on test day.
Absolutely. A personalized approach to ACT prep means spending more time on your weaker sections while maintaining your strengths. For example, if you're strong in Math but struggle with Reading comprehension, your prep can be weighted accordingly. Varsity Tutors connects you with tutors who can customize the 8-week curriculum to target your specific challenges and maximize your overall score.
Most students benefit from taking 4-6 full-length practice tests spread throughout the 8 weeks—roughly one every 1-2 weeks. Early tests help identify weak areas, mid-course tests track progress and refine strategies, and final tests build test-day confidence. Between full tests, targeted practice on individual sections keeps skills sharp. Your tutor can recommend a practice schedule that fits your pace and goals.
Confidence comes from preparation and familiarity. By working through hundreds of real ACT questions, learning the exact format and timing, and practicing under timed conditions, you reduce the unknown factor that fuels anxiety. An 8-week prep class also builds mental strategies for staying calm under pressure, managing stress, and maintaining focus during the test. Students who feel prepared tend to perform closer to their practice test scores.
